ใภ้
Thai
Etymology
From Proto-Tai *baɰꟲ (“daughter-in-law”); Lao ໃພ້ (phai), Northern Thai ᨻᩱ᩶, Khün ᨻᩱ᩶, Lü ᦺᦗᧉ (pay²), Shan ပႂ် (pǎue), Zuojiang Zhuang bawx, Zhuang bawx.
